About this role:
Landscape Design & Planning –
Develop creative and functional landscape designs for public spaces, commercial properties, and residential developments.

Project Conceptualization & Visualization –
Create detailed site plans, sketches, and 3D renderings using CAD software to present design concepts.

Environmental & Sustainability Integration –
Incorporate sustainable landscaping solutions, including native plant selection, water-efficient irrigation systems, and eco-friendly materials.

Site Analysis & Feasibility Studies –
Conduct site assessments, analyzing topography, soil conditions, climate, and ecological factors to determine project feasibility.

Urban Planning & Public Space Development –
Collaborate with city planners and architects to design landscapes that enhance urban environments and promote green spaces.

Irrigation & Drainage System Design –
Develop water-efficient irrigation and drainage plans to ensure plant health while conserving resources.

Collaboration with Architects & Engineers –
Work closely with architectural and engineering teams to integrate landscape features into broader infrastructure projects.

Budgeting & Cost Estimation –
Prepare cost estimates, material lists, and budget plans to ensure projects remain financially viable.

Regulatory Compliance & Permitting –
Ensure that designs adhere to local zoning laws, environmental regulations, and industry standards.

Construction Oversight & Quality Control –
Supervise landscape construction projects, ensuring design integrity, material quality, and compliance with specifications.

Client Consultation & Presentation –
Communicate design proposals to clients, stakeholders, and decision-makers, incorporating feedback into final plans.

Biodiversity & Green Infrastructure Planning –
Design wildlife-friendly landscapes, rooftop gardens, and green corridors to enhance urban biodiversity.

Innovative Landscape Solutions –
Research and implement the latest trends in landscape architecture, sustainable urban design, and climate-responsive planning.

Project Management & Timeline Coordination –
Oversee project execution, ensuring that work progresses on schedule and within budget.

Qualifications:
Bachelor’s Degree (Mandatory):
Bachelor’s Degree in Landscape Architecture (BLA) or Bachelor of Science in Landscape Architecture (BSLA)
Master’s Degree (Preferred but not mandatory):
Master’s in Landscape Architecture (MLA) – Ideal for advanced design expertise, sustainability planning, and urban development projects.
Minimum 5–10 years of experience in landscape architecture, urban planning, or site development (depending on project scale and complexity).
Proven experience in designing, planning, and executing landscaping projects for commercial, residential, and public spaces.
Strong ability to create functional, aesthetically pleasing, and sustainable landscape designs for urban, commercial, and residential spaces.
Expertise in site planning, master planning, and land-use analysis to optimize outdoor spaces.
Ability to blend natural elements with built environments while maintaining environmental balance.
Advanced skills in AutoCAD, SketchUp, Revit, GIS, Lumion, and other landscape design software for digital modeling and rendering.
Proficiency in Adobe Photoshop, Illustrator, and InDesign for creating presentations and visualizations.
Strong understanding of BIM (Building Information Modeling) for large-scale projects.
Knowledge of green infrastructure planning, ecological restoration, and sustainable landscaping techniques.
Experience in designing water-efficient irrigation systems, xeriscaping, and rainwater harvesting solutions.
Understanding of LEED certification principles and how to integrate them into landscaping projects.
Strong expertise in irrigation planning, water management, and drainage system optimization.
Ability to design efficient stormwater management solutions to prevent erosion and flooding.
